    I am sorry to have missed this meeting, from the logs it sounded quite interesting.

    I would like to highlight one statement from Virta about player events:

    "Big projects are often too cumbersome to run, to the point where nobody is having fun. Lot of small events are more fun."

    I really could not agree more with this. It's not just that small events are so much easier to organise, frequent events also make it easier for people to attend at least some of the time. It's a win-win combination.

    I also like the idea of having some sort of "small events" competition, though perhaps it could be more like an expo than an actual competition. Calling it an expo inspires a more collaborative and friendly atmosphere. Maybe we could even workshop some of the ideas togethger.

    Regardless it's a fantastic idea. We should start I new thread just to work out the details.

    When talking about RP events, I like small events that spiral off, but one of the problems I was (and am) trying to address by way of large plots is exposure. The RP community, from my view, is kinda hard to get into if you don't join a RP org. Even if you do, you still have to expose yourself and build up 'street cred'. I think having player run large plots, even if it takes a little work, would allow us the oportunity to bring closet RPers out of the wood work by giving them in game groups to identify with and say "hey I can role-play with these people" or give them an 'in' to role-play about. The disadvantage to ARK plots in this case is that while you can discuss it as a news story, or do little role-plays among those effected by the events, it would be highly irregular somebody to just say to the ARKs "I go hunt down Bahirae". With player run plots we can accomodate that within reason.

    Virta and I have an idea we’d like to discuss at the Greencoat about having a Roleplaying Festival. It sort of builds on the notion of having a Small Events contest, but in a way which is more friendly, open and informal.

    The basic idea is really simple. It involves us, as community, agreeing to mark a limited, arbitrary span of time (say for example the last two weeks of March) as A Roleplaying Festival.

    During the Festival we simple invite everyone to focus at little more on the roleplaying aspect of the game, either through staging events, improvised stuff on the streets or indeed in any way individuals are more comfortable with. There will be no Festival organisers or leaders, no rules, no red tape. But hopefully, if we are all more involved in roleplaying at the same time, interesting dynamics will emerge of their on accord.

    Or maybe not.

    Anyway, as I said, it’s all pretty rough at the moment, but maybe if we can discuss this at the Greencoats we can work out the details and make something workable out of this.
